Overview

A custom dispatch management platform is a purpose-built software system designed to automate and optimize the assignment and tracking of tasks, resources, or personnel. It replaces manual or spreadsheet-based methods with intelligent algorithms that consider variables like location, availability, and priority. Businesses in logistics, field services, and healthcare increasingly adopt these platforms to reduce operational inefficiencies and improve customer satisfaction. These platforms often integrate with GPS, CRM, and ERP systems to provide end-to-end visibility. Customization allows organizations to align the software with their unique workflows, compliance requirements, and reporting needs. The result is a scalable solution that adapts to growing demands while maintaining accuracy and accountability.

Key Features

Modern dispatch platforms offer real-time tracking, enabling managers to monitor task progress and adjust assignments dynamically. Automated scheduling algorithms optimize routes and reduce idle time, lowering fuel costs and improving service speed. Advanced analytics provide insights into performance metrics, helping businesses identify bottlenecks and opportunities for improvement. Multi-channel integration ensures seamless communication between dispatchers, field workers, and customers via mobile apps, SMS, or email. Customizable workflows allow businesses to tailor the platform to specific industries, such as prioritizing emergency repairs in healthcare or balancing load capacities in logistics. Cloud-based deployments further enhance accessibility and scalability.

Application Areas

Logistics companies leverage dispatch platforms to coordinate fleets, track deliveries, and minimize delays. Field service providers, such as HVAC or plumbing businesses, use them to assign technicians based on proximity and skill set. Healthcare organizations deploy these systems for ambulance routing or home-care visit scheduling, ensuring timely patient care. Delivery services benefit from optimized route planning and real-time driver updates, enhancing customer transparency. Municipalities apply dispatch solutions for waste management or emergency response, where efficient resource allocation is critical. The versatility of these platforms makes them indispensable across sectors reliant on mobile workforce coordination.

Precautions

When implementing a custom dispatch platform, compatibility with existing software (e.g., ERP, accounting systems) is crucial to avoid disruptions. Data security must be prioritized, especially for industries handling sensitive information like healthcare or legal services. Ensure the platform complies with regional regulations, such as GDPR for European operations. Scalability is another key consideration; the system should accommodate business growth without requiring frequent overhauls. Vendor reliability and post-implementation support are equally important—opt for providers with proven track records and responsive customer service. Pilot testing with a small team can help identify potential issues before full-scale deployment.

B2B Procurement Guide

Procuring a dispatch management platform begins with a needs assessment: list must-have features (e.g., GPS integration, reporting tools) and industry-specific requirements. Request demos or case studies from vendors to evaluate usability and effectiveness. Compare pricing models (subscription vs. one-time license) and hidden costs like training or updates. Engage stakeholders—dispatchers, field staff, IT teams—in the selection process to ensure the solution meets operational needs. Negotiate service-level agreements (SLAs) for uptime guarantees and support responsiveness. For reference, mid-tier platforms typically range from $10,000 to $30,000, while enterprise solutions with advanced AI capabilities may exceed $50,000. Consider modular solutions that allow incremental feature additions as needs evolve.
